Transaction 507ea5024e97a3c8f54751979819538b95fa0cfe7372901666b450681216e603

1 Input
2 Outputs
  • 507ea5024e97a3c8f54751979819538b95fa0cfe7372901666b450681216e603:0
  • value  3120874
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 507ea5024e97a3c8f54751979819538b95fa0cfe7372901666b450681216e603:1
  • value  9900000
    address  34SnsNaNcbc1YXajMQE29GU37VerHnDrAW